Tips to Plan a Successful Group Trip in a Minibus

Group road trips are probably the most interactive and fun, but they require meticulous planning to promise a relaxing and easygoing experience. Even though it is a no-brainer that when a group comes together, fun and adventure are promised, their individualistic experiences contribute to their overall mood and pleasure. When preparing for a group trip in a minibus, there are several key points that you can check to ensure the journey is successful.

Get a Budget

One of the most crucial things when traveling in groups is the budget. When budgets are not discussed in a healthy manner, it can lead to multiple disagreements and feelings of resentment. From hotel room choices to adventures and activities, the budget can seriously alter the bond of the group. In the minibus spectrum, the budget can vary for the amenities, the route, and pit stops during your trip, as toll taxes, fuel, and parking tickets can pile up and become huge. So, find the right budget that serves everyone in your group.

Tip: Always leave a buffer, as some days you are going to want to spend a little more than you planned.

Plan Your Itinerary

When traveling in groups, planning your moves can save time and keep your journey smooth. You can accumulate the list of places everyone wants to visit and plan your route and days accordingly. Make sure to leave extra time for breakfast, lunch, dinner, and other necessities, including fuel stops. You can pre-book restaurants and download offline maps for easy access.

Pack For Your Pack

What this essentially means is that while you pack for yourself, make a little effort to accumulate for your group as well. Things like snacks, drinks, an extra pair of sunglasses, sunscreen, regular aspirin, and a first aid kit are a few of the items that one can undoubtedly pack in if they have extra space. Furthermore, you can discuss this with your group to avoid ineffective luggage. For example, there is no need to pack eight hair dryers during group travel, one can easily do the job. These approaches make your trip wholesome and stress-free.

Ensure Minibus Quality

Before you start your trip, ensure that everyone has ample space to themselves. If not, you can choose to be transported by a different minibus. A little delay is better than hours of discomfort. Apart from comfort and amenities, you can take an extra step by ensuring safety. You can do these by inspecting the lights, brakes, and insurance terms of your vehicle. Additionally, you can also inspect your driver’s license to make sure you are in the right hands.
